As I blog my flat in smelling the best its ever smelled. A friend of mine recently set up a business making and selling candles. The business is called Wicked Candles and it just so happens that Im moving house next week and want it to smell Christmassy.
I'm a right fusspot though and wont buy anything unless I can smell it.

Today I received some samples in the form of small melting tarts which you can buy from Wicked Candles for just £1 (GBP). As soon as they popped through the letter box I couldnt wait to open them. I could smell something delicious inside the packaging and I wasnt disappointed. I received 9 and each one smells good enough to eat.


The 9 samples I received are:

Lazy Daze - A blend of freshly baked apples and cinammon.
Coffee Caramel Cream - Indulge in a wonderfully rich smelling candle
Witches Cauldron - Nothing wicked is brewing in our witches cauldron, just sugar cookies and bananas.
Amaretto - Indulge in this beautiful smelling candle, without the hangover in the morning.
Cinderella - A beautiful cinammon candle with the soft undertone of vanilla, this candle will warm your home without being overbearing.
Autumn Spice
Irish Cream - enjoy the smell of an irish cream coffee all year round with this beautiful candle.
Strawberry Cheesecake - Good enough to eat
Creamy Vanilla Fudge - This one was actually specially made for me on request so if you have any specific requests for your favourite scent just get in touch with Wicked Candles and Jeri will hopefully be able to get your special scent made for you.

All of them smell delicious, I just want to eat them.

Wicked Candles have a selection of scents for each season as well as specials and the candle of the month and Im particularly excited by the Christmas scents which include 'Santas Treats' which smells like cookies and 'Frosty the Snowman' which is a refreshing minty scent. If youre just gearing up for Autumn and Halloween Id definitely recommend the Witches Cauldron, although some of the other Autumn Scents sound great and the Candle of the month for November will be Toffee Apple.

This time of year Im very partial to Cinammon smells and they cater really well for that. I'll definitely be ordering Autumn Spice, Witches Cauldron and Lazy Daze. Strawberry Cheesecake and Cinderella will also be considered. The coffee collection for me was quite sweet smelling but perfect for coffee lovers. The Irish Cream smells exactly like Baileys and during Christmas my house will probably smell like that anyway without the help of a candle :p

It may also be worth noting that all of the candles are hand crafted using a blend of ecosoy wax for a longer burn time and theyre available in  tart form, small, medium, large and extra large jars and the coffee collection come in 7oz coffee glasses.
